Text Quotes
If ever they remembered their life in this world it was as one remembers a dream (C S Lewis Quotes)
There is a kind of happiness and wonder that makes you serious. It is too good to waste on jokes (C S Lewis Quotes)
It is my opinion that a story worth reading only in childhood is not worth reading even then (C S Lewis Quotes)
It is not your business to succeed, but to do right. When you have done so the rest lies with God (C S Lewis Quotes)
If the world is meaningless, then so are we; if we mean something, we do not mean alone (C S Lewis Quotes)
We can never know what might have been but what is to come is another matter entirely (C S Lewis Quotes)
Why love if losing hurts so much? We love to know that we are not alone (C S Lewis Quotes)
If you do one good deed your reward usually is to be set to do another and harder and better one (C S Lewis Quotes)
A world of automata – of creatures that worked like machines – would hardly be worth creating (C S Lewis Quotes)
The very first tear he made was so deep that I thought it had gone right into my heart (C S Lewis Quotes)
Look for the valleys, the green places, and fly through them. There will always be a way through (C S Lewis Quotes)
It is very true. But even a traitor may mend. I have known one who did (C S Lewis Quotes)
A thing may be morally neutral and yet the desire for that thing may be dangerous (C S Lewis Quotes)
I now see that I spent most of my life in doing neither what I ought nor what I liked (C S Lewis Quotes)
The next best thing to being wise oneself is to live in a circle of those who are (C S Lewis Quotes)
The grave and the image are equally links with the irrecoverable and symbols for the unimaginable (C S Lewis Quotes)
If they won’t write the kind of books we like to read we shall have to write them ourselves (C S Lewis Quotes)
Life is too deep for words, so don’t try to describe it, just live it (C S Lewis Quotes)
The heart never takes the place of the head: but it can, and should, obey it (C S Lewis Quotes)
If you love deeply, you’re going to get hurt badly. But it’s still worth it (C S Lewis Quotes)
If you had felt yourself sufficient, it would have been a proof that you were not (C S Lewis Quotes)
The best swordsman in the world may be disarmed by a trick that’s new to him (C S Lewis Quotes)
One of the most cowardly things ordinary people do is to shut their eyes to facts (C S Lewis Quotes)
You weren’t a decent man and you didn’t do your best. We none of us were and none of us did (C S Lewis Quotes)
Grief is like a long valley, a winding valley where any bend may reveal a totally new landscape (C S Lewis Quotes)
Good, as it ripens, becomes continually more different not only from evil but from other good (C S Lewis Quotes)
The present is the only time in which any duty may be done or grace received (C S Lewis Quotes)
Pride gets no pleasure out of having something, only out of having more of it than the next man (C S Lewis Quotes)
You cannot make men good by law: and without good men you cannot have a good society (C S Lewis Quotes)
If one could run without getting tired I don’t think one would often want to do anything else (C S Lewis Quotes)
